South Africa’s request to ICJ to prevent an unprecedented massacre in Rafah
Geneva - South Africa’s 12 February request to the International Court of Justice (ICJ) concerning Israel’s decision to extend its military operations in Rafah is welcomed by Euro-Med Monitor, the rights group said in a statement on Wednesday. Rafah is the last remaining shelter for displaced people and survivors of Israel’s ongoing genocide against Palestinians in the Gaza Strip, the group noted.
Euro-Med Monitor emphasised the significance of the request, which South Africa made as part of its reaction to the horrific events unfolding in the Strip, particularly in the governorate of Rafah, which was home to roughly 280,000 Palestinians prior to the current Israeli attacks. Today, over 1.4 million people, or more than half of the Gaza Strip's population, are living in Rafah Governorate. The majority of these people are children, and they came to Rafah from all over the Strip in response to military evacuation orders from Israel.
The Israeli military attacks against Rafah have already begun, Euro-Med Monitor warned, and include killing, starvation, and deprivation of health services. Israel’s army has killed about 280 people in Rafah—including about 155 women and children—following the issuance of the ICJ’s decision on 26 January, which acknowledged that Israel has violated its obligations under the Genocide Convention. Since then, the Israeli army has completely or partially destroyed about 220 housing units in the Gaza Strip. Furthermore, the dire humanitarian needs of the Palestinian people in Rafah Governorate have not been met.

Amnesty director says international law in ‘death throes’
Agnes Callamard, secretary general of the human rights watchdog Amnesty International, has penned an article in the magazine Foreign Affairs stating that Israel’s war in Gaza represents the “culmination of years of erosion of the international rule of law and global human rights system”.

Hezbollah says it launched 10 attacks against Israel on Thursday
In a statement summing up its military operations, the Lebanese group said it targeted Israeli bases in the disputed Shebaa Farms, which Lebanon claims as its own, and fired dozens of rockets at the northern Israeli town of Kiryat Shmona.

Here are some of the main developments:
The Israeli military has raided Nasser Hospital in Khan Younis, firing on the facility and expelling patients and medical workers from one of Gaza’s last functional hospitals.
Hamas has called the move a “blatant war crime” and rejected allegations it uses Nasser Hospital for military purposes, saying that Israel is in a “new episode in the series of lies” to justify attacks on medical facilities.
A UNICEF spokesperson says while the agency has some access to southern Gaza, aid in the north has been “nonexistent since the beginning of this year”.
The White House has confirmed that Israel is preventing flour from reaching Gaza, where people are facing an imminent risk of famine.
